Background

Death receptor-6 (DR6), also known as TNFRSF21, is a type I transmembrane protein and member of the death domain-containing TNFR superfamily. DR6 is expressed in most human tissues and the highest levels were detected in heart, brain, placenta, pancreas, thymus, lymph node and several non-lymphoid cancer cell lines. It functions as a regulatory receptor for mediating CD4(+) T cell activation and maintaining proper immune responses (1). DR6 interacts with the adaptor protein TRADD and mediates signal transduction through its death domain, and expression of DR6 in mammalian cells induces activation of both NF-κB and JNK and cell apoptosis (2). In addition, DR6 is uniquely cleaved from the cell surface of tumor cell lines by MMP-14, which is associated with tumor malignancy. The ligand for DR6 has not been identified.
